Devlin is a loser...or so his adulterous girlfriend told him, and his father, and his mother in her overbearing, tentative head-stroking kind of way. Time for a new start, a different city and a new place to call home. His flat reveals a secret: a journal that belonged to the woman who was here before him. Just a peak - the turning of one page leads to another, leads to revelatory visions of a place and a power that permeates the complex in which he lives, calling into question the apparent innocence of its residents. Why did she leave? How did she leave? In his search for answers he learns of a ravaged, hate-filled history belonging to a different world and time. He finds a strength to dig beyond the acceptance of disclosure, past the lies and deception, deeper into the darkness of a magic and a world beyond the walls of plaster and brick to the core of what awaits him: a new identity, death, darkness and a love shrouded in displaced recollection and malice.
